Lungfish survive the dry season by burrowing into mud and entering a state of estivation, a form of dormancy that allows them to conserve energy and moisture. They secrete a mucous cocoon that helps retain moisture while minimizing metabolic activity. During this period, lungfish can breathe air using their lungs, allowing them to survive in oxygen-poor environments until water levels rise again. This adaptation enables them to endure prolonged periods without water.
A period of inactivity during hot, dry summer months is commonly referred to as "estivation." This behavioral adaptation allows certain animals to conserve energy and avoid harsh environmental conditions by entering a state of dormancy. Estivation is similar to hibernation but occurs in response to high temperatures and limited water availability instead of cold conditions.
